Introduction to Gypsum Powder Processing

Gypsum powder, derived from gypsum rock, is a versatile material used primarily in plaster, drywall, and cement industries. The processing of gypsum powder requires specific equipment that can handle the material's unique characteristics. Identifying the right gypsum powder processing equipment is crucial for manufacturers aiming to boost output and maintain quality.

Crushing and Grinding Equipment

The first stage in gypsum powder processing involves crushing the raw gypsum rock. This is where crushers, such as jaw crushers and impact crushers, come into play. These machines break down the rock into smaller particles, facilitating easier transport and further processing.

Once the gypsum is crushed, grinding mills—such as ball mills and Raymond mills—are used to turn the raw material into fine powder. The grinding process is vital because it determines the fineness and purity of the final product. Employing high-quality gypsum powder processing equipment in these stages significantly enhances production efficiency and leads to better-quality powder.

Calcination Process

After grinding, the next step in gypsum processing is calcination. This process involves heating the gypsum powder to remove moisture and convert it to calcium sulfate hemihydrate, commonly known as Plaster of Paris. The equipment used in this stage includes rotary kilns and calcining mills.

Rotary kilns are favored in large-scale operations due to their efficient heat application and continuous processing capabilities. On the other hand, calcining mills provide more controlled conditions for smaller batches. The choice of calcination equipment can directly affect the product's quality and the efficiency of the production process.

Once the gypsum has been processed and calcined, it is crucial to package it properly to ensure quality and prevent contamination. This is where specialized packaging systems come into play. Automated packaging lines equipped with weigh scales, bagging machines, and sealing units streamline the process, allowing for precise measurements and efficient handling.

Additionally, incorporating quality control systems in conjunction with your gypsum powder processing equipment can help ensure consistency and compliance with industry standards. Regular monitoring of production quality can lead to less waste and improved overall efficiency.
